Morphine is undoubtedly an opioid analgesic indicated in the cure of acute and chronic average to critical agony. From the pharmacodynamic standpoint, morphine exerts its results by agonizing mu‐opioid receptors predominantly, leading to analgesia and sedation. Pharmacokinetically, morphine is largely metabolized inside the liver by using glucuronidation by the enzyme uridine diphosphate glucuronosyltransferase relatives 2 member B7 and encounters the transporter proteins organic and natural cation transporter isoform one and P‐glycoprotein (adenosine triphosphate–binding cassette subfamily B member one) as it's becoming distributed through the body.

Together with the liver, human Mind homogenates have been shown to metabolize morphine at nanomolar concentrations to M3G and M6G; thus, M6G is usually shaped straight while in the CNS and appears to penetrate the BBB in a better charge as proleviate natures morphine opposed to M6G produced during the liver (Yamada et al. 2003). Curiously, the M3G/M6G ratio made by the brain homogenates has long been observed to be instantly linked to morphine concentration.

The genes coding with the proteins impacting both the pharmacokinetics or pharmacodynamics of morphine may perhaps bear genetic versions, also known as polymorphisms, which can change the operate in the proteins in this kind of way that a person can have disparate therapy outcomes. The goal of this overview is to highlight a number of the genes coding for proteins that affect morphine pharmacokinetics and pharmacodynamics and existing some treatment method issues.
